Suppose the mean number of days to germination of a variety of seeds is 34, with a standard deviation of 4.3 days. What is the probability that the mean germination time of a sample of 250 seeds will be within 0.5 days of the population mean?
We have a normal distribution, "\\mu=34, \\sigma=4.3, n=250."
Let's convert it to the standard normal distribution, "z=\\cfrac{\\bar{x}-\\mu}{\\sigma\/\\sqrt{n}}" ;
"z_1=\\cfrac{33.5-34}{4.3\/\\sqrt{250}}=-1.84, \\\\ z_2=\\cfrac{34.5-34}{4.3\/\\sqrt{250}}=1.84,"
"P(33.5<\\bar{X}<34.5)=\\\\\n=P(-1.84<Z<1.84)=\\\\\n=P(Z<1.84)-P(Z<-1.84)="
"=0.9671-0.0329=0.9342" (from z-table).
